Artist Bio:
The Pretenders are a British-American rock band formed in 1978 in Hereford, England. The band's original members included lead vocalist and rhythm guitarist Chrissie Hynde, lead guitarist James Honeyman-Scott, bassist Pete Farndon, and drummer Martin Chambers. They achieved commercial success with hits like "Brass in Pocket," "Back on the Chain Gang," and "Don't Get Me Wrong."


The band's music is characterized by a mix of punk, new wave, and pop rock elements. Chrissie Hynde's distinctive voice and songwriting have been key to the band's enduring popularity. Over the years, the Pretenders have undergone several lineup changes due to the deaths of Honeyman-Scott and Farndon, but Hynde has remained a constant presence. The band has released several critically acclaimed albums and continues to tour and record new music.
